H6784 - Dry
| Strong's No.: | H6784 |
| Hebrew: | צָמַק |
| Transliteration: | tsâmaq |
| Phonetic: | tsaw-mak' |
| Word Origin: | A primitive root |
| Bible Usage: | dry. |
| Part of Speech: | Verb |
| Strongs Definition: | to dry up |
| Brown Driver Biggs Definition: | 1. to dry, dry up, shrivel a. (Qal) to shrivel (of women's breasts) |
